Ganga Aarti in Varanasi is a mesmerizing spiritual ritual held daily at
sunset on the sacred ghats of the River Ganges. This ancient ceremony,
performed by priests with oil lamps, incense, and devotional songs,
honors the holy Ganga and symbolizes the eternal bond between humanity
and the divine. Witnessing the Ganga Aarti at Dashashwamedh Ghat is a
transformative experience, offering a glimpse into India’s rich cultural
heritage and spiritual traditions. A must-visit for travelers seeking
